Patents by Inventor Jingwei Shi

Jingwei Shi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8275765
    Abstract: The present invention provides a method and system for automatic objects classification. The method comprises: acquiring a set of objects; classifying the objects based on query log to generate a first classification result; classifying the objects based on ontological information to generate a second classification result; and semantically fusing the first and second classification results to generate a final classification result. According to the present invention, compared with the prior arts, by semantically fusing the query log-based classification result and the ontology-based classification result, the accuracy and user-friendness of the object classification can be improved.
    Type: Grant
    Filed: October 28, 2009
    Date of Patent: September 25, 2012
    Assignee: NEC (China) Co., Ltd.
    Inventors: Jianqiang Li, Xin Meng, Yu Zhao, Jingwei Shi
  • Publication number: 20110239141
    Abstract: Here is disclosed a method, an apparatus and a system for identifying a Graphical User Interface (GUI) element. According to an aspect of the present invention, a method of generating a GUI element identification information comprises: displaying a GUI which includes a target GUI element; analyzing the displayed GUI, to acquire attribute information for the target GUI element; acquiring extra information, other than the attribute information, related to the target GUI element; and processing the attribute information and the extra information to generate the identification information for the target GUI element.
    Type: Application
    Filed: January 24, 2011
    Publication date: September 29, 2011
    Applicant: NEC (CHINA) CO., LTD.
    Inventors: Lian WANG, Xin MENG, Cailiang SONG, Huifeng LIU, Jingwei SHI, Xiaowei LIU
  • Publication number: 20110239127
    Abstract: The present invention provides a customizing system and a customizing method for converting a desktop application into a web application. A required processing logic may be added by locating an interface element which is needed to be modified, and modifying a callback function of the interface element (interface description data), so as to implement user's operations on local data by a web application. When a user operates on the modified interface element at a browser side, the added processing logic automatically converts the user's operation to a plurality of operations, so that the user may feel that he is operating on a local file at the browser side, rather than a remote file at a server side. The present invention may implement complex webpage function customization, and thus may implement remote operations on local data.
    Type: Application
    Filed: January 24, 2011
    Publication date: September 29, 2011
    Applicant: NEC (China) Co., Ltd.
    Inventors: Xin MENG, Cailiang Song, Jingwei Shi, Lian Wang, Huifeng Liu, Xiaowei Liu
  • Publication number: 20110231784
    Abstract: The present invention provides a system and a method for desktop application migration, which are divided to a development phase and an actual runtime phase. During the development phase, interface description data of each window are dumped by traversing all windows of a desktop application; a raw template is semi-automatically generated using the interface description data of each window; it is further designated manually and/or according to rules which parts are “data-type interface elements” based on the raw template, so as to form a final template. During the actual runtime phase, the interface description data of the desktop application are obtained in real time, and values and attribute information of the “data-type interface elements” are dumped therefrom for filling in the template, in order to form a finally-presented webpage. The present invention significantly improves efficiency of creating a new web application and saves development costs by semi-automatically generating the templates.
    Type: Application
    Filed: January 24, 2011
    Publication date: September 22, 2011
    Applicant: NEC (CHINA) CO., LTD.
    Inventors: Xin MENG, Cailiang SONG, Jingwei SHI, Lian WANG, Huifeng LIU, Xiaowei LIU
  • Publication number: 20110035435
    Abstract: The present invention provides methods and systems for converting a desktop application to a Web application. The method comprises: inputting, at a client side, URL of a desired desktop application and sending it to a server; the server providing a code conversion tool (e.g. JavaScript code) to the client and loading the desktop application; at the server, extracting interface information of the loaded desktop application, wrapping the interface information to data in an interface descriptive language format (e.g. XML data), and sending the wrapped data back to the client; and at the client, parsing the XML data by utilizing the code conversion tool to generate relevant webpage elements (e.g. HTML data), so as to display the desktop application. In another embodiment, the server can directly run the code conversion tool to implement the code conversion from XML data to HTML webpage elements.
    Type: Application
    Filed: June 18, 2010
    Publication date: February 10, 2011
    Applicant: NEC (CHINA) CO., LTD.
    Inventors: Xin MENG, Jingwei SHI, Cailiang SONG, Lian WANG, Huifeng LIU, Xiaowei LIU
  • Publication number: 20100114855
    Abstract: The present invention provides a method and system for automatic objects classification. The method comprises: acquiring a set of objects; classifying the objects based on query log to generate a first classification result; classifying the objects based on ontological information to generate a second classification result; and semantically fusing the first and second classification results to generate a final classification result. According to the present invention, compared with the prior arts, by semantically fusing the query log-based classification result and the ontology-based classification result, the accuracy and user-friendness of the object classification can be improved.
    Type: Application
    Filed: October 28, 2009
    Publication date: May 6, 2010
    Applicant: NEC (China) Co., Ltd.
    Inventors: Jianqiang Li, Xin Meng, Yu Zhao, Jingwei Shi